Output ff9656b76140eadec626f043b1f3cb87ae71313beaf5e4635d8abcbcc087015c:62

value
35757
script pubkey
OP_0 OP_PUSHBYTES_20 f89e3c6cc1df542e48e28b9e4e35a24cfb2d1dd6
address
bc1qlz0rcmxpma2zuj8z3w0yuddzfnaj68wk4hlh8a
transaction
ff9656b76140eadec626f043b1f3cb87ae71313beaf5e4635d8abcbcc087015c
spent
true